Warning Signs You Need Restaurant Water Damage Restoration

Water damage in restaurants can be a hidden threat, but there are warning signs that show you need professional help.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even business closure.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your restaurant can show water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to mold growth and health risks.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can be a sign of water damage. Inspect your floors regularly to catch these signs early and prevent further damage.

Water Stains or Discoloration on Walls

Water stains or discoloration on walls can show water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and health risks.

Leaks or Water Damage Under Appliances

Leaks or water damage under appliances can be a sign of a larger issue. Inspect your appliances regularly to catch these signs early and prevent further damage.

Unusual Sounds or Sights

Unusual sounds or sights, such as dripping water or water pooling, can show water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and health risks.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under a sink Yes No You can fix small leaks yourself with a DIY repair kit.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Water damage from a burst pipe needs professional equipment and expertise to dry and restore the affected areas.
Water stains on walls Maybe Yes Water stains on walls can be a sign of a larger issue, such as water damage or mold growth. Call a professional to inspect and repair the affected areas.
Musty odors in the kitchen No Yes Musty odors in the kitchen can show mold growth or water damage. Call a professional to inspect and repair the affected areas.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Cost in Somerset, WI

The cost of Restaurant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Somerset, WI.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ate based on your specific needs.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ted.
Cleaning and sanitizing $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the type of surfaces affected.
Reconstruction and repair $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the type of materials needed for repair.
